一种检测视力的方法和终端技术

技术编号:19169042 阅读:27 留言:0更新日期:2018-10-16 22:58
本发明专利技术公开了一种检测视力的方法和终端,用以解决现有技术中存在的检测视力时检测者和视力表之间的距离有要求的问题。本发明专利技术实施例终端通过摄像头和传感器获取用户眼睛和终端的显示屏幕之间的距离,此距离为测试距离,终端根据视力等级、测试距离以及检测图形的映射关系,确定当前检测到的测试距离和当前的视力等级对应的检测图形。终端上显示确定的检测图形,并根据识别到的用户行为和显示的检测图形,确定视力检测结果。由于终端中存储视力等级、测试距离以及检测图形的映射关系,所以检测视力时不需要固定距离的要求,从而使用户可以随时检测视力,有助于视力保护。

Method and terminal for detecting eyesight

The invention discloses a method and a terminal for detecting visual acuity, which can solve the problem that the distance between the inspector and the visual acuity table is required when detecting visual acuity in the prior art. The terminal of the embodiment of the invention obtains the distance between the user's eyes and the display screen of the terminal through a camera and a sensor. The distance is a test distance. The terminal determines the test distance currently detected and the detection graph corresponding to the current visual acuity level according to the visual acuity level, the test distance and the mapping relationship between the detection graph. The terminal displays the determined detection graphics, and determines the visual acuity detection results according to the identified user behavior and the displayed detection graphics. Because the terminal stores the visual acuity grade, test distance and the mapping relation of the test pattern, the requirement of fixed distance is not needed when detecting the visual acuity, so that the user can detect the visual acuity at any time, which is helpful to the protection of the visual acuity.

【技术实现步骤摘要】
一种检测视力的方法和终端
本专利技术涉及电子
,特别涉及一种检测视力的方法和终端。
技术介绍
随着科学技术的进步,越来越多的电子产品进入人们的生活,人们对电子产品的依赖也越来越严重,比如用电子产品看视频、聊天、看小说等。然而长时间面对电子产品,会使用户产生视觉疲劳,如果眼睛长期处于疲劳状态,则会给视力带来不可恢复的影响。不定时检测视力,知晓视力状况,可以起到提前保护视力的作用。传统的检测视力的方法通常是使用国际标准视力表,检测者站在距离国际标准视力表5米处,医护人员指示不同的国际标准视力表上的图形“E”,检测者根据医护人员指示的国际标准视力表上的图形“E”,回答图形“E”的开口方向,医护人员根据检测者回答的结果判断检测者的视力级别。由此可以看出,传统的检测视力的方法对检测者和视力表之间的距离有固定的要求。
技术实现思路
本专利技术提供一种检测视力的方法和终端,用以解决现有技术中存在的检测视力时检测者和视力表之间的距离有固定要求的问题。第一方面,本专利技术实施例提供的一种检测视力的方法,包括:终端根据视力等级、测试距离以及检测图形的映射关系,确定当前检测到的测试距离和当前的视力等级对本文档来自技高网...

【技术保护点】
1.一种检测视力的方法,其特征在于,该方法包括:终端根据视力等级、测试距离以及检测图形的映射关系,确定当前检测到的测试距离和当前的视力等级对应的检测图形,其中测试距离为用户眼睛和终端的显示屏幕之间的距离;所述终端根据确定的检测图形进行显示;所述终端根据识别到的用户行为和显示的检测图形,确定视力检测结果。

【技术特征摘要】
1.一种检测视力的方法,其特征在于,该方法包括:终端根据视力等级、测试距离以及检测图形的映射关系,确定当前检测到的测试距离和当前的视力等级对应的检测图形,其中测试距离为用户眼睛和终端的显示屏幕之间的距离;所述终端根据确定的检测图形进行显示;所述终端根据识别到的用户行为和显示的检测图形,确定视力检测结果。2.如权利要求1所述的方法,其特征在于,所述终端根据确定的检测图形进行显示,包括:若确定的检测图形有一个,则所述终端显示确定的检测图形;或若确定的检测图形有多个,则所述终端从确定的多个检测图形中选择一个,并显示选择的检测图形。3.如权利要求1所述的方法,其特征在于,所述终端确定当前检测到的测试距离和当前的视力等级对应的检测图形之前,还包括:所述终端确定满足触发条件;其中,所述触发条件包括下列中的部分或全部:用户触发进行视力检测;确定进行视力边界检测;上一次进行非视力边界检测的视力等级大于上一次之前进行非视力边界检测的视力等级,且上一次进行非视力边界检测的视力检测结果为正确;上一次进行非视力边界检测的视力等级小于上一次之前进行非视力边界检测的视力等级,且上一次进行非视力边界检测的视力检测结果为错误;完成首次进行非视力边界检测。4.如权利要求3所述的方法,其特征在于,所述终端根据下列方式确定当前的视力等级:若首次进行视力检测,则所述终端将用户选择的视力等级作为当前的视力等级;或若上一次进行非视力边界检测的视力检测结果为正确,且上一次的视力等级大于上一次之前进行非视力边界检测的视力等级,则所述终端将上一次进行非视力边界检测的视力等级进行提升,并将提升后的视力等级作为当前的视力等级;或若上一次进行非视力边界检测的视力检测结果为错误,且上一次的视力等级小于上一次之前进行非视力边界检测的视力等级,则所述终端将上一次进行非视力边界检测的视力等级进行降低,并将降低后的视力等级作为当前的视力等级。5.如权利要求4所述的方法,其特征在于,所述终端根据识别到的用户行为和显示的检测图形,确定视力检测结果之后,还包括:若当前是非视力边界检测,且当前的视力等级为最高视力等级,则所述终端将最高视力等级作为用户的视力;或若当前是非视力边界检测,且当前的视力等级为最低视力等级,则所述终端将最低视力等级作为用户的视力;或若当前是非视力边界检测,且当前的视力等级不是最高视力等级或最低视力等级,则所述终端将确定的视力检测结果作为上一次进行非视力边界检测的视力检测结果。6.如权利要求3所述的方法,其特征在于,所述终端确定进行视力边界检测,包括:若上一次进行非视力边界检测的视力等级大于上一次之前进行非视力边界检测的视力等级,且上一次进行非视力边界检测的视力检测结果为错误,则所述终端确定进行视力边界检测;或若上一次进行非视力边界检测的视力等级小于上一次之前进行非视力边界检测的视力等级,且上一次进行非视力边界检测的视力检测结果为正确,则所述终端确定进行视力边界检测。7.如权利要求6所述的方法,其特征在于,所述终端根据下列方式确定当前的视力等级:若当前是视力边界检测,且上一次是非视力边界检测,且上一次进行非视力边界检测的视力等级小于上一次之前进行非视力边界检测的视力等级,且上一次进行非视力边界检测的视力检测结果为正确,则将上一次视力等级作为当前的视力等级;或若当前是视力边界检测,且上一次是非视力边界检测,且上一次进行非视力边界检测的视力等级大于上一次之前进行非视力边界检测的视力等级,且上一次进行非视力边界检测的视力检测结果为错误,则将上一次视力等级进行降低,并将降低后的视力等级作为当前视力等级;或若当前是视力边界测试,且上一次是视力边界检测,且上一次视力边界检测的视力检测结果为错误,则所述终端将上一次进行视力边界检测的视力等级进行降低,并将降低后的视力等级作为当前的视力等级;或若当前是视力边界测试,且上一次是视力边界检测,且上一次视力边界检测的视力检测结果为正确,则所述终端将上一次进行视力边界检测的视力等级作为当前的视力等级。8.如权利要求7所述的方法,其特征在于,所述终端根据识别到的用户行为和显示的检测图形,确定视力检测结果之后,还包括:若当前是视力边界测试,且当前进行视力边界检测的视力等级的视力检测结果正确次数达到设定阈值,则所述终端将当前进行视力边界检测的视力等级作为用户的视力;或若当前是视力边界测试,且确定的视力检测结果为错误,且当前进行视力边界检测的视力等级不是最低视力等级,则所述终端将确定的视力检测结果作为上一次进行视边界力检测的视力检测结果;或若当前是视力边界测试,且确定的视力检测结果为错误,且当前进行视力边界检测的视力等级是最低视力等级,则所述终端将最低视力等级作为用户的视力。9.一种检测视力的终端,其特征在于,该终端包括:至少一个处理单元、以及至少一个存储单元,其中,所述存储单元存储有程序代码,当所述程序代码被所述处理...

【专利技术属性】
技术研发人员:李招艳李学鹍王能申
申请(专利权)人:珠海格力电器股份有限公司
类型:发明
国别省市:广东,44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1